Forty-eight parcels of Cannabis Sativa, worth N4.9 million have been handed to the National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A) by the North-East Joint Task Force, Damaturu, Yobe State.
The handing over was performed by the Sector Commander of the task force, Major General Koko Isoni in Damaturu.
Major Isoni, who was represented by his Chief of Staff, Brigadier General Umar Mu’azu, said the substances were seized on October 7, 2022, by troops of the 159 Battalion in Geidam Local Government Area of the state.
“It was abandoned by the courier including the vehicle conveying the consignment when he saw the patrol team,” he said.
Reacting, the State Commandant of NDLEA, Aliyu Yahaya, commended the army for the gesture, adding that each parcel of Cannabis costs N50,000.
Represented by the Deputy State Commandant, Ogar Peter, Yahaya appreciated the synergy between the security agencies in the state.
“We are pleased to receive this exhibit. The gesture demonstrates the synergy that exists between the security agencies in the state,” he said, adding the Nigerian Army has been committed to curve drug peddling in the state.
